## Stale-branch bot

Tidywick is our stale-branch cleanup bot. It flags branches with no commits in 90 days, posts a warning, then deletes after 14 more days unless someone objects. Support can pause deletions per-repo through the Tidywick admin console. Console requests to the internal service must include the API key shown below.

API key for tagef-fafop: vxb2-ta

Quotafold autoscaler API, contractor notes. The service reads queue depth from the Pipestack broker and adjusts worker replicas via the orchestration endpoint. Core routes: GET /depth returns per-queue backlog, POST /policy sets thresholds, and GET /history returns recent scaling decisions. Thresholds are per-queue; do not set global values without sign-off. All calls require a bearer token scoped to the staging cluster. Rate limit is 60 requests per minute. The staging key you should use is below.

service key, fawip-bajef: kto11_Qt5wZK9vdNC

Onboarding note for the eng sync: the Thornbury Library catalogue import runs nightly via the `catim` worker. It pulls MARC records from the Selwick feed, normalizes them, and upserts into the catalogue DB. New folks: clone the repo, copy `.env.sample` to `.env`, and set `CATIM_BATCH_SIZE` (500 is safe locally). Failed records land in the `quarantine` table; re-run with `--retry`. The Selwick feed endpoint authenticates with a client secret, which belongs on the next line.

env line for fafof-fahag: LEDGER_TOKEN5=f8790

TURN-208: Gatevale turnstile counters at the Merrow Field pilot double-count when a rotation reverses mid-cycle. Attendance totals drift roughly 2% high per event. The debounce window fix is implemented, reviewed by Ilsa, and soak-tested across two simulated match days without drift. Ready for your cut; the candidate build is identified below.

trace token, tagag-tafog: htk6_5ed18c